All of the cards at the event featured products from the Stampin’ Up! 2019 Holiday Catalog, including this little guy who’s featured in the Birds of a Feather Stamp Set. There are four “birds” in this set, including a Halloween Duck which you’ve already seen here, a Thanksgiving turkey (naturally), and a rooster holding a cute little heart (yes, Valentine’s Day is in this group!). Each of the birds has at least one sentiment that goes along with it, and the “wishing you a Joyful Christmas from our little flock” sentiment is on the inside of this card.
The colors featured here are those in the fun Let It Snow Specialty Designer Series Paper – Coastal Cabana, Real Red and Whisper White. Coastal Cabana is a new Christmas color for me, but it does seem to work, especially with some of the paper from that paper set included in the card.
I love the little copper colored star from the Star Designer Elements Set that’s also in the Holiday Catalog. But the nicest touch as far as I’m concerned is that fluffy Snowfall Accents Puff Paint on the little bird’s hat. That is just so much fun. Hint: Be sure to heat set it to make it puff up!
